I think he is tlaking abotu the actual rim...

Its very commone for people to run Zr1 style rims 17X9.5 in the front and 17X11 in the rear... you can put stuff like 315s in the rear on 17X11s... I think I have even heard 335

Check the appearance and suspension sectiosn they talk of what is needed to do this....

If it helps any I have 17X9.5s, with 275/40/17 on all 4 corners. No problems bump or rubbing...
